Output fec7828e72982e1e5e3726c17c11e3289d94b125a168d00f64d806605a0eb93e:1

value
393945933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0959a14a323621f7ab997ce17759a3f8d900194 OP_EQUAL
address
MUNeovN4pWzDz3BswNp4SCQbAF8Mfeyp4M
transaction
fec7828e72982e1e5e3726c17c11e3289d94b125a168d00f64d806605a0eb93e
spent
true